Punitive damages
If a defendant’s actions are so reckless and impulsive that it is considered to be fraud, they could be ordered to pay punitive damages. These damages are intended to penalize the defendant and discourage others from engaging in the same behavior. These damages typically constitute less than the total compensation award and are given in addition to compensatory damages.

The procedure for filing an asbestos lawsuit varies according to the state, however there are generally certain criteria to meet in order to receive compensation. The statute of limitations, or deadline for filing a lawsuit is one of these criteria. A mesothelioma lawyer can help clients understand and comply with the time limit.
An asbestos claim must be supported by evidence that proves that the person who was involved was exposed and suffered injury due to the exposure. It can be difficult to prove this, but a qualified asbestos lawyer will be able to collect the necessary evidence. They can utilize historical work records, manufacturing blueprints and other documentation to prove that a client was exposed to asbestos and injured as a consequence.
In certain cases the victim will receive compensation from multiple asbestos companies. The court will then allocate the blame among these defendants and award damages according to the amount. In this situation the victims will need to negotiate with each firm for the most effective settlement.
Asbestos lawyers can assist their clients in obtaining compensation from asbestos trust funds. These are bank accounts that were set by asbestos companies to hold their insurance funds. These trusts currently hold over $30 billion of unused funds. To be eligible for these funds, an individual must be diagnosed with asbestos-related diseases and provide proof of their exposure.
